As of August 01, 2026, the average salary for a Data Control Clerk II in the United States is $50,104 per year, which breaks down to an hourly rate of $24.
However, a Data Control Clerk II's salary can vary significantly. Here’s a look at the typical salary range:
Data Control Clerk II Salaries by Percentile
| Annual Salary |
Monthly Pay |
Weekly Pay |
Hourly Wage |
|
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 75th Percentile | $57,672 | $4,806 | $1,109 | $28 |
| Average | $50,104 | $4,175 | $964 | $24 |
| 25th Percentile | $46,305 | $3,859 | $890 | $22 |

Experience is a primary driver of a Data Control Clerk II's salary. As you build your skills and take on more complex tasks, your compensation generally increases. Here's how the average salary grows at different career stages:
| Job Role | Years of Experience | Average Salary |
|---|---|---|
| Data Control Clerk I | 0-1 years | $45,348 |
| Data Control Clerk II | 1-3 years | $50,104 |
| Data Control Clerk III | 3-5 years | $56,648 |
| Data Control Supervisor | 5+ years | $87,325 |
| Data Governance Supervisor | 5+ years | $114,185 |

Reviews, codes, and inputs source data from storage media into a computer processing system. Compares output to control totals and makes corrections to codes and batches as necessary. Prepares and distributes output reports as instructed. Requires a high school diploma or equivalent. Typically reports to a supervisor. Works under moderate supervision. Gaining or has attained full proficiency in a specific area of discipline. Typically requires 1-3 years of related experience.
